Provider & Default Compute
You do NOT need to specify a provider — just pass "serviceType": "image_gen" and the system will automatically route to the correct provider.
Never try to query provider lists, read compute.json, or explore available models through API calls. The models listed below are guaranteed to work.
Model Selection
| Model | Characteristics | When to use |
|---|---|---|
| gpt-image-2 | High quality, fast, versatile styles | Default — use when user does not specify a model |
| wan2.7-image | Standard high quality (requires DashScope provider) | Only when user explicitly asks for Wan / DashScope |
| wan2.7-image-pro | Flagship, 4K resolution (requires DashScope provider) | Only when user explicitly asks for top quality Wan model |
Default rule: if the user does not specify a model, use gpt-image-2.
Note: wan2.7-image and wan2.7-image-pro only work when the user has configured their own Alibaba Cloud DashScope provider. If you get an error with these models, fall back to gpt-image-2.
Full Execution Flow (strictly follow these steps)
How to get the API address
The system prompt already contains the agent-service API address under the local API section (e.g. Agent Service: https://127.0.0.1:61000). Extract the URL from there and use it directly.
If for any reason you cannot find it in the system prompt, use this fallback:
PORT=$(cat "${DESIRECORE_HOME:-$HOME/.desirecore}/agent-service.port")
# Then use https://127.0.0.1:${PORT}
Step 1: Generate the image (single curl command)
Call /images/generations through media-proxy. You MUST use this exact request structure — do not add messages, response_format, or any other parameters not shown here:
# Save response to a temp file to avoid base64 flooding the terminal
curl -sk -X POST "https://127.0.0.1:${PORT}/api/media-proxy" \
-H "Content-Type: application/json" \
-d '{
"serviceType": "image_gen",
"endpoint": "/images/generations",
"body": {
"model": "gpt-image-2",
"prompt": "Replace this with the image description (English usually gives better results)",
"size": "1024x1024",
"n": 1
},
"responseType": "json"
}' -o /tmp/dashscope-response.json
# Check success and extract b64_json directly to image file (NEVER cat the response to stdout)
python3 -c "
import json, base64, sys
with open('/tmp/dashscope-response.json') as f:
resp = json.load(f)
if not resp.get('success'):
print('ERROR:', json.dumps(resp, ensure_ascii=False)[:500])
sys.exit(1)
b64 = resp['data']['data'][0]['b64_json']
with open('/tmp/dashscope-gen.png', 'wb') as f:
f.write(base64.b64decode(b64))
print('OK: saved to /tmp/dashscope-gen.png')
"
CRITICAL: The response contains a large base64 image (~2MB). NEVER print the raw response or b64_json to the terminal. Always save to file with -o and extract with the python3 script above.
Response format (saved in /tmp/dashscope-response.json):
{
"success": true,
"data": {
"created": 1781060911,
"data": [{"b64_json": "<very large base64 string>"}],
"size": "1024x1024"
}
}
Step 2: Upload to media-store
curl -sk -X POST "https://127.0.0.1:${PORT}/api/media/upload" \
-F "file=@/tmp/dashscope-gen.png;type=image/png"
Pick the mediaId field from the JSON response (format xxxxxxxx-xxxx-xxxx-xxxx-xxxxxxxxxxxx.png).

Parameter Mapping
Size selection
Pass size in the body object:
{
"model": "gpt-image-2",
"prompt": "your image description",
"size": "1024x1024",
"n": 1
}
| User intent | size value |
|---|---|
| Square / avatar / default | "1024x1024" |
| Landscape / scenery / wallpaper | "1536x1024" |
| Portrait / mobile / poster | "1024x1536" |

Error Handling
| Error | Meaning | Action |
|---|---|---|
"No matching provider" |
No enabled provider supports image_gen |
Tell user to enable a provider with image_gen support in settings |
"API Key not configured" |
API Key missing | Tell user to configure API key |
statusCode: 401 |
API Key invalid or expired | Tell user to check API key |
statusCode: 429 |
Rate limited | Wait and retry once |
statusCode: 400 + model_price_error |
Model not available on current provider | Switch to gpt-image-2 and retry |
statusCode: 400 |
Other bad parameters | Check model name and size are from the tables above |
On model error: If wan2.7-image or wan2.7-image-pro fails with model_price_error, automatically retry with gpt-image-2. Do NOT ask the user before retrying.
On other errors: Report the error to the user clearly. Do NOT try alternative endpoints or read config files.
